THE HEALING SOLUTION
• To avoid direct contact with primates and rodents, such
as monkeys and squirrels, or people who are infected
• Be diligent in washing your hands with soap and water,
or alcohol-based hand sanitizers, especially before eating,
touching your nose or eyes, and cleaning wounds.
• Avoid sharing cutlery or using the same bed linen with
people infected with monkey pox.
• To prevent transmission, doctors can administer variola
vaccine, especially for medical staff who treat monkey
pox patients. In addition to variola vaccination, medical
staff also need to wear personal protective equipment
when treating patients
